5 Uses For

A Practical Roadmap for Converting HTML to PDF Using .NET Core

Turning HTML into PDF files using .NET Core can make content management more efficient and improve compatibility across devices. Whether you’re dealing with reports, invoices, or interactive web pages, generating PDF files from HTML ensures consistency in formatting, structure, and appearance. This conversion process is especially valuable when you need shareable, print-ready documents generated directly from web-based sources.

Adding HTML to PDF capabilities into your .NET Core application enables diverse and useful implementations. You can, for instance, take live HTML and convert it into a PDF while keeping intact the fonts, media, and CSS styling. Fields that prioritize accurate records, such as medical, legal, retail, and financial sectors, find this tool indispensable for proper documentation. Here’s the link to learn more about the awesome product here.

To begin working with HTML to PDF in .NET Core, it’s essential to understand the structure of your content. HTML, being the core of online documents, is built for rendering in web browsers and is inherently adaptable. Unlike HTML, PDFs have a rigid structure, so the end result should mirror a consistent format irrespective of platform. Ensuring that your HTML is clean, responsive, and styled appropriately will increase the chances of accurate conversion. Click here to get even more info on the subject!

Usually, converting HTML into a PDF in .NET Core involves using a headless browser or rendering service that snapshots the HTML content as a PDF. The output preserves all the formatting, CSS, and JavaScript embedded within the original HTML. You can generate PDF documents from static pages or dynamic content generated within your application. In scenarios where your software outputs receipts or data forms, they can be promptly turned into PDFs ready for download. You can read more on the subject here!

You must also account for information protection and data reliability. Generating documents on the server via .NET Core helps shield private content from unauthorized client access. When the conversion happens within your app’s ecosystem, you gain both independence from third-party APIs and improved oversight of the process. This page has all the info you need.

Another key benefit is the level of versatility this method offers. No matter the HTML source-whether from Razor templates, REST APIs, or embedded views-.NET Core supports seamless integration and scalability. It’s possible to schedule automated conversions, produce PDFs in bulk, or enable live PDF generation directly from your app’s interface. View here for more info on this product.

When implementing this functionality, ensure your application processes different content types appropriately. Proper embedding or referencing of styles, visuals, and fonts is essential for accurate PDF output. Inline styling usually performs more reliably than linked stylesheets, particularly when working offline or with local resources.

You should also consider how performance influences your application’s output speed and stability. Optimized routines ensure quick load times and minimal wait periods, creating a smoother experience for users. Using asynchronous functions allows your application to remain responsive even when handling complex PDF conversions. Speed improvements can also come from caching repeated elements like media and design files. Click here for more helpful tips on this company.

At its core, HTML to PDF integration in .NET Core ensures the delivery of high-quality, professional-looking documents that mirror the quality of your original content. Such functionality allows you to create systems that deliver both usability and visually professional results, giving users access to print-ready versions instantly.